On Feb 11 04:52, Minwoo Im wrote: > nvme_inject_state command is to give a controller state to be. > Human Monitor Interface(HMP) supports users to make controller to a > specified state of: > > normal: Normal state (no injection) > cmd-interrupted: Commands will be interrupted internally > > This patch is just a start to give dynamic command from the HMP to the > QEMU NVMe device model. If "cmd-interrupted" state is given, then the > controller will return all the CQ entries with Command Interrupts status > code. > > Usage: > -device nvme,id=nvme0,.... > > (qemu) nvme_inject_state nvme0 cmd-interrupted > > <All the commands will be interrupted internally> > > (qemu) nvme_inject_state nvme0 normal > > This feature is required to test Linux kernel NVMe driver for the > command retry feature. >
This is super cool and commands like this feel much nicer than the qom-set approach that the SMART critical warning feature took. But... looking at the existing commands I don't think we can "bloat" it up with a device specific command like this, but I don't know the policy around this.
